Principy skupiny svazků aplikací Azure NetApp Files pro Oracle

Skupina svazků aplikací pro Oracle umožňuje nasadit všechny svazky potřebné k instalaci a provozu databází Oracle v podnikovém měřítku s optimálním výkonem a podle osvědčených postupů v jednom kroku a optimalizovaném pracovním postupu. Funkce skupiny svazků aplikací používá možnost Azure NetApp Files umístit všechny svazky do stejné zóny dostupnosti jako virtuální počítače k dosažení automatizovaných nasazení optimalizovaných pro latenci.

Skupina svazků aplikací pro Oracle implementovala mnoho technických vylepšení, která zjednodušují a standardizují celý proces, což vám pomůže zjednodušit nasazení svazků pro Oracle. Všechny požadované svazky, například až osm datových svazků, protokoly online opakování a archivní protokoly opakování, zálohování a binární soubory, se vytvářejí v jediné "atomické" operaci (prostřednictvím webu Azure Portal, rp nebo rozhraní API).

Skupina svazků aplikací Azure NetApp Files zkracuje dobu nasazení databáze Oracle a zvyšuje celkový výkon a stabilitu aplikace, včetně použití více koncových bodů úložiště. Funkce skupiny svazků aplikací podporuje širokou škálu rozložení databáze Oracle od malých databází s jedním svazkem až po více databází o velikosti 100 TiB. Podporuje až osm datových svazků s výkonem optimalizovaným pro latenci a je omezen pouze síťovými možnostmi databázového virtuálního počítače.

Použití více svazků připojených prostřednictvím více koncových bodů úložiště, jak je nasazeno skupinou svazků aplikací pro Oracle, přináší vylepšení výkonu popsaná v databázi Oracle na více svazcích článku.

Skupina svazků aplikací pro Oracle je podporovaná ve všech oblastech s povolenými službami Azure NetApp Files.

Klíčové funkce

Skupina svazků aplikací pro Oracle poskytuje následující možnosti:

  • Podpora velké varianty konfigurací Oracle začínajících 2 svazky pro menší databáze až 12 svazků pro obrovské databáze až několik stovek TiB.
  • Vytvoření následujícího rozložení svazku:
    • Data: Jeden až osm datových svazků
    • Protokol: Svazek protokolu online znovu (log) a volitelně druhý svazek protokolu () vlog-mirror případě potřeby
    • Binární soubor: Svazek pro binární soubory Oracle (volitelné)
    • Zálohování: Svazek protokolu pro archivaci zálohování protokolů (volitelné)
  • Vytváření svazků v ručním fondu kapacity QoS
    Velikost svazku a požadovaný výkon (v MiB/s) se navrhují na základě uživatelského vstupu pro velikost databáze a požadavky na propustnost databáze.
  • Grafické uživatelské rozhraní skupiny svazků aplikací a šablona Azure Resource Manageru (ARM) poskytují osvědčené postupy pro zjednodušení správy velikosti a vytváření svazků. Příklad:
    • Navrhování zásad vytváření názvů svazků na základě ID systému (SID) a typu svazku
    • Výpočet velikosti a výkonu na základě vstupu uživatele

Skupina svazků aplikací pro Oracle pomáhá zjednodušit proces nasazení a zvýšit výkon úložiště pro úlohy Oracle. Některé nové funkce jsou následující:

  • Použití umístění zóny dostupnosti k zajištění umístění svazků do stejné zóny jako výpočetní virtuální počítače.
    Na vyžádání je umístění svazku založeného na PPG dostupné pro oblasti bez zón dostupnosti, což vyžaduje ruční proces.
  • Vytvoření samostatných koncových bodů úložiště (s různými IP adresami) pro svazky dat a protokolů
    Tato metoda nasazení poskytuje lepší výkon a propustnost databáze Oracle.

Rozložení skupiny svazků aplikace

Skupina svazků aplikací pro Oracle nasadí více svazků na základě vašeho vstupu a dostupnosti prostředků ve vybrané oblasti a zóně podle následujících pravidel:

  • AVG může nasadit 1 až 8 dat, protokolů (a volitelně, log-zrcadlo), zálohování a binární svazky ve vybrané zóně pomocí stejného nastavení síťových funkcí (Standard nebo Basic) a stejné verze NFS (NFSv4.1 nebo NFSv3).
  • Fond kapacity hostování musí být nakonfigurovaný pomocí ruční technologie QoS.
  • Datové svazky se nasazují podle pravidel ochrany proti spřažení, aby se zajistilo jejich rozložení do co největšího počtu koncových bodů úložiště Azure NetApp Files ve vybrané zóně. Svazky mají také přiřazené přímé koncové body úložiště pro co nejlepší možnou latenci.
  • Až tři datové svazky je možné nasadit na stejný koncový bod úložiště v zónách s omezenými prostředky, pokud to umožňují požadavky na kapacitu a propustnost.
  • Protokoly, zrcadlení protokolů a záložní svazky se nasazují podle pravidel bez seskupení: žádný z těchto svazků nemůže sdílet koncové body úložiště. Tyto svazky mají přiřazené přímé koncové body úložiště.
  • Binární svazek může sdílet koncový bod úložiště se záložním svazkem a nevyžaduje přímý koncový bod úložiště.

Nasazení s vysokou dostupností budou zahrnovat svazky ve 2 zónách dostupnosti, pro které můžete nasazovat svazky pomocí skupiny svazků aplikací pro Oracle v obou zónách. Můžete použít replikaci dat založenou na aplikacích, jako je ochrana Data Guard. Příklad rozložení svazku se dvěma zónami:

Nasazení s vysokou dostupností zahrnují svazky ve dvou zónách dostupnosti, pro které můžete nasadit svazky pomocí skupiny svazků aplikací pro Oracle v obou zónách. Můžete použít replikaci dat založenou na aplikacích, jako je ochrana Data Guard. Příklad rozložení svazku se dvěma zónami:

Diagram rozložení svazku se dvěma zónami

Plně sestavené nasazení s osmi datovými svazky a všemi volitelnými svazky v zóně s vysokou dostupností prostředků může vypadat přibližně takto:

Diagram nasazení Oracle

V zónách omezených prostředky můžou být svazky nasazeny na koncové body sdíleného úložiště kvůli výše uvedeným algoritmům ochrany proti spřažení a bez seskupení. Tento diagram znázorňuje ukázkové rozložení svazku v zóně s omezenými prostředky:

Diagram osmi rozložení objemu dat

V zónách s omezenými prostředky se svazky nasazují na koncové body sdíleného úložiště při zachování spřažení a pravidel bez seskupení. Výsledné rozložení zobrazuje svazky protokolu a zrcadlení protokolů na koncových bodech privátního úložiště, zatímco datové svazky sdílejí koncové body úložiště. Svazky protokolu a zrcadlení protokolů nesdílely koncové body úložiště.

Další kroky